| Produto: | TOTVS Varejo Franquias e Redes |
|---|---|
| Linha de Produto: | Franquias e Redes |
| Segmento: | Varejo |
| Módulo: | PDV OMNI |
| Função: | Acesso supervisor |
| Ticket: | |
| Requisito/Story/Issue (informe o requisito relacionado) : | DVAROMNICK-822 |
Ao realizar a leitura do código de barras do crachá do supervisor com o parâmetro “Digitar senha do supervisor no PinPad” habilitado, o sistema fica travado na tela de digitação de senha, impossibilitando o cancelamento da operação.
O comportamento ocorre somente quando este parâmetro está ativo; caso contrário, o fluxo de entrada no modo supervisor funciona normalmente.
Os seguintes parâmetros devem estar habilitados:
Desconsiderar o dígito na identificação do vendedor
Desconsiderar o dígito na identificação do supervisor
Digitar senha do supervisor no PinPad
Com todos os parâmetros acima ativos, acessar a tela de configurações utilizando um crachá de supervisor (via leitura do código de barras).
Como o parâmetro "Digitar senha do supervisor no PinPad" está habilitado, ao bipar o crachá o sistema deveria redirecionar diretamente para a etapa de digitação da senha.
No entanto, nesse momento ocorrem os seguintes problemas:
Ao tentar digitar a senha do supervisor na tela, a interface exibe o campo de senha normalmente, porém não é mais possível cancelar a operação.
A aplicação fica travada nessa tela, exigindo que o processo seja finalizado manualmente.
Caso o usuário clique em Cancelar para digitar a senha na tela (em vez do PinPad), o sistema exibe a interface aguardando a senha pelo PinPad, porém:
O procedimento no PinPad não é iniciado.
A opção de cancelar novamente também não funciona.
O sistema permanece travado neste estado.
Foi ajustado o fluxo de identificação do supervisor para garantir que, ao bipar o crachá com o parâmetro “Digitar senha do supervisor no PinPad” habilitado, o sistema execute corretamente apenas um único ponto de entrada para a etapa de digitação de senha.
A correção impede chamadas duplicadas do processo e garante que o PinPad seja inicializado somente quando necessário, mantendo habilitada a opção de cancelamento.
Após a correção, o fluxo passou a funcionar conforme esperado:
O supervisor é identificado corretamente via leitura do crachá.
A tela direciona de forma adequada para a digitação da senha.
O PinPad inicia o processo sem travamentos.
O cancelamento volta a operar normalmente.
Com isso, a autenticação do supervisor foi realizada com sucesso em todos os cenários testados.

N\A.
Não se aplica
Aplicação de desconto em produtos KIT.
Desconto manual em KIT passa a ser bloqueado.
| TOTVS PDV Omni | 4.2.X.0 |